Material Costs - The cost for wood siding materials typically ranges from $3 to $8 per square foot, depending on the type of wood selected such as cedar or pine. Larger projects may see higher total material expenses based on the siding’s quality and grade.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for wood siding replacement generally fall between $2 and $5 per square foot. These costs vary based on project complexity, siding removal, and local labor rates in West Chicago, IL and surrounding areas.
Additional Costs - Expenses for surface preparation, such as removing old siding or repairing underlying structures, can add $1 to $3 per square foot. These costs depend on the condition of the existing surface and the scope of preparatory work needed.
Total Project Estimates - Overall replacement costs typically range from $6 to $16 per square foot, including materials and labor. For a standard 1,000-square-foot installation, this translates to approximately $6,000 to $16,000, varying by project specifics.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s that wood siding needs to be replaced? Signs include rotting, warping, extensive cracking, insect damage, or if the siding no longer provides proper protection for the building.
Can wood siding be repaired instead of replaced? In some cases, minor damage can be repaired; however, extensive deterioration often requires complete replacement to ensure durability and appearance.
What types of wood siding are available for replacement? Various options include cedar, pine, redwood, and engineered wood siding, each offering different aesthetics and durability levels.
